Book Description
Are ants animals? Do rabbits actually like lipstick? Are dogs really human? Does being kind to animals mean you can be cruel to people? Should a girl fall in love with her English teacher? Susie Harding joins the Animal Rights Federation because she has a crush on the teacher that organises it. She's not that convinced about becoming an animal rights activist.
